On-site notes: holy-water stoup with roughly hemispherical basin bearing the date 1696; the base has a thick upper ring or moulding and the stem is round with a slight bulging centre. [NB: cf. Index entry for Palau-de-Cerdagne No. 1 for a remarkable baptismal font in this church]
